Report navmesh change for not posted tiles
Corresponding recast mesh tiles can be updated but navmesh tiles may never
appear for them. Report back zero navmesh version to allow oscillating recast
objects detection to work. This version is always less than any generated
navmesh tile version so any report for generated navmesh will override it.
If zero navmesh version is reported after recast mesh tile got report about
generated navmesh tile it is a no-op since generated version is always greater
than zero.

#ifndef OPENMW_COMPONENTS_DETOURNAVIGATOR_RECASTMESHMANAGER_H
#define OPENMW_COMPONENTS_DETOURNAVIGATOR_RECASTMESHMANAGER_H
#include "recastmeshbuilder.hpp"
#include "oscillatingrecastmeshobject.hpp"
#include "objectid.hpp"
#include "version.hpp"
#include <LinearMath/btTransform.h>
#include <osg/Vec2i>
#include <list>
#include <map>
#include <optional>
#include <unordered_map>
class btCollisionShape;
namespace DetourNavigator
{
struct RemovedRecastMeshObject
{
std::reference_wrapper<const btCollisionShape> mShape;
btTransform mTransform;
};
class RecastMeshManager
{
public:
struct Water
{
int mCellSize = 0;
btTransform mTransform;
};
RecastMeshManager(const Settings& settings, const TileBounds& bounds, std::size_t generation);
bool addObject(const ObjectId id, const btCollisionShape& shape, const btTransform& transform,
const AreaType areaType);
bool updateObject(const ObjectId id, const btTransform& transform, const AreaType areaType);
bool addWater(const osg::Vec2i& cellPosition, const int cellSize, const btTransform& transform);
std::optional<Water> removeWater(const osg::Vec2i& cellPosition);
std::optional<RemovedRecastMeshObject> removeObject(const ObjectId id);
std::shared_ptr<RecastMesh> getMesh();
bool isEmpty() const;
void reportNavMeshChange(Version recastMeshVersion, Version navMeshVersion);
Version getVersion() const;
private:
struct Report
{
std::size_t mRevision;
Version mNavMeshVersion;
};
std::size_t mRevision = 0;
std::size_t mGeneration;
RecastMeshBuilder mMeshBuilder;
std::list<OscillatingRecastMeshObject> mObjectsOrder;
std::unordered_map<ObjectId, std::list<OscillatingRecastMeshObject>::iterator> mObjects;
std::list<Water> mWaterOrder;
std::map<osg::Vec2i, std::list<Water>::iterator> mWater;
std::optional<Report> mLastNavMeshReportedChange;
std::optional<Report> mLastNavMeshReport;
void rebuild();
};
}
#endif
